Master Schedule Key

  • Select: SR=Seats Remaining, C=Closed, NR=Not available for registration
  • CRN: Course Reference Number; the five-digit number used to identify a specific section of a course when registering ex: 23743 ENG 101-016 (click on the course CRN to find course description, required prerequisites, textbook list and other important course information)
  • Course: Identifies the course subject, course number and section—ex: ENG 101 016 = English 101, section 016
  • Campus: BC= Brighton Campus, DCC=Downtown Campus, ATC=Applied Tech Center, PSTF= Public Safety Training Facility, SLN = Online, OFC=Off Campus, LOC=On Location
  • Credits: Hours awarded for successful completion of a course
  • Title: Identifies the name of the course, may be abbreviated as a prefix ex: ACC = Accounting
  • Open Seats: Identifies the number of seats available in a class out of its capacity
  • Waitlist: (LW) An electronic list of students who want to enroll in a class after it has closed or reached maximum capacity
  • Days: M=Monday, T=Tuesday, W=Wednesday, R=Thursday, F=Friday, S=Saturday, TR=Tuesday and Thursday (note: online courses do not have specific meeting days)
  • Time: Identifies the hours the class meets (note: TBA is listed for online courses, as they do not have specific meeting times)
  • Instructor: Faculty member teaching the course (P) = Primary Instructor
  • Dates: The date range the class meets
  • Location: The first number identifies the building where the class meets; the second number identifies the room number, ex:
    • 12 129 = Brighton building 12, room 129
    • DC 365 = Downtown Campus, room 365
    • PSTF 103 = Public Safety Training Facility, room 103
    • ATC 116 = Applied Tech Center, room 116
  • TBA: To be announced; in reference to instructor or room location

Special/Reserved Section Notations

  • Automotive = Reserved for those in an automotive program
  • COIL = Collaborative Online International Learning; partners with classrooms in other countries
  • EOP = Educational Opportunity Program
  • ESOL = Reserved for students who are enrolled in English for Speakers of Other Languages
  • Fast Track –LC = Combined courses learning community designed to help students progress through a sequence in one semester
  • Flexible Paced Course = Self-directed course in which learning material is delivered via computer using online software with videos and interactive assignments; instructors work one-on-one with students, helping them at their point of need
  • GR = Open to all students; coursework is presented with a focus on sustainability (studies the interactions of humans, economics and ecology in a holistic manner)
  • HOC = Honors Option Course (3 seats reserved for Honors-eligible students who will do honors level work in addition to the standard work of the course)
  • HON = Reserved for honors-eligible students
  • Hybrid = Part online, part in-class learning
  • LC = Learning Community; course must be registered with the additional course as noted
  • OER = Open Educational Resources- courses that have low or no-cost textbook alternative
  • SOAR = Self-Directing, Over-Achieving and Responsible (reserved for African, African-American and Latino male students)
  • SV = Service Learning; combines civic engagement with academic coursework
  • SLN= Online course
  • UR = URSICA Undergrad Research Scholarly Inquiry and Creative Activity; high impact practice effective in promoting student retention and completion including class and faculty mentored research
  • WR = Writing Intensive; must meet prerequisite for ENG 101 or have completed ENG 101
